Tyson Fury weighs lighter than opponent Mariusz Wach for first time in 15 years
Summary

Tyson Fury weighed in at 18st 13lb (120kg), 26 pounds lighter than Mariusz Wach's 20st 11lb (132kg) before their heavyweight bout in Pattaya, Thailand. This marks the first instance in 15 years that Fury has been lighter than an opponent, a rarity in his 38-fight professional career. The bout, taking place in front of about 1,500 spectators, is not being broadcasted. Fury expressed confidence and a desire to stay active, potentially planning up to 10 fights this year, amid speculation about a future clash with Anthony Joshua.

By the Numbers
  • Fury last weighed less than an opponent in 2011 against Derek Chisora.
  • The fight is not televised, limiting visibility for both fighters.
  • Fury aims for increased activity in 2026 with multiple fights planned.
  • Wach has lost seven of his last ten fights, including a knockout in 2024.
